&lt;b&gt;PESHAWAR: A suicide bomber killed at least eight people and wounded 43 others when he rammed his motorcycle into a bus on University Road here on Monday, police said.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
The bombing took place at Peshawar&#39;s Jehangir Abad neighbourhood on Arbab Road close to a police vehicle and also damaged a passing bus.&lt;br /&gt;
&quot;The commissioner, who passed just a minute before from the road, was the target of the bombing, but he escaped unhurt as the bomber missed the target and struck his motorcycle into a passenger bus,&quot; police official said.&lt;br /&gt;
Body parts of the suicide bomber were also found at the blast site, he added.&lt;br /&gt;
Bomb disposal officials said the explosives weighed up to six kilograms (13 pounds).&lt;br /&gt;
Rescue teams shifted the bodies and injured to Khyber Teaching Hospital while police cordoned off the area and started investigation.&lt;br /&gt;
The University Road was closed for traffic after the incident.&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;span style=&quot;font-size: 1.00016em; line-height: 1.286em;&quot;&gt;Almost every visitor to Far North Queensland has the tropical town of Cairns on their itinerary. As the gateway to the iconic&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.greatbarrierreef.org/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; font-size: 1.00016em; line-height: 1.286em;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;Great Barrier Reef&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size: 1.00016em; line-height: 1.286em;&quot;&gt;and fringed by jungle-covered mountains, littered with white-sand beaches and home to a surprisingly cosmopolitan nightlife scene, it is little wonder this erstwhile fishing village has become one of Australia’s top tourist destinations. But for those who are willing to look beyond Cairns’ obvious attractions – and have the energy to get out of their deck chair – there is a wealth of delightful alternatives within an hour’s drive of the coast’s sticky climes.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; color: #505050; font-family: arial, helvetica, sans-serif; font-size: 14px; line-height: 1.286em; padding: 0px 0px 10px;&quot;&gt;
The Atherton Tablelands is a cool, clean and astonishingly green volcanic plateau with vistas more reminiscent of Switzerland than sunburnt Australia; dairy cows munch yellow flowers, tractors trundle down meandering tracks and blue lakes wink at the base of impossibly rounded emerald hills. But do not mistake bucolic for boring: the 32,000sqkm region – which soars to heights of almost 1,300m – packs a dramatic punch in the sightseeing stakes.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; color: #505050; font-family: arial, helvetica, sans-serif; font-size: 14px; line-height: 1.286em; padding: 0px 0px 10px;&quot;&gt;
The Tablelands are a short and scenic drive inland from Cairns, but for those who believe the journey should be as thrilling as the destination, the&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.ksr.com.au/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;Kuranda Scenic Railway&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;– a 37km mountain edge train track constructed in the late 1800s – and&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.skyrail.com.au/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;Skyrail&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;– a 7.5km-long cableway gliding above the jungle canopy – are delightful alternatives. Both start in Cairns and terminate in Kuranda, a hippy hamlet nestled between a World Heritage-listed rainforest and the Barron Falls, which roars to life in the summer monsoon season. Billed as “the village in the rainforest”, Kuranda offers prime nature experiences both outside and in: more than 80 types of winged wonders flutter about in the&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.birdworldkuranda.com/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;Birdworld&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;complex, while the&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.australianbutterflies.com/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;Butterfly Sanctuary&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;is Australia’s largest butterfly aviary. But the town’s most interesting inhabitants can be found at the Original Markets at the northern end of town, a ramshackle, sandalwood-scented jumble of stalls flogging everything from avocado ice cream to organic lingerie until 3 pm every day.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; color: #505050; font-family: arial, helvetica, sans-serif; font-size: 14px; line-height: 1.286em; padding: 0px 0px 10px;&quot;&gt;
Trade the sarongs for spurs with a 30km drive west to the cowboy town of Mareeba. Home to one of Australia’s&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.mareebarodeo.com.au/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;most iconic annual rodeos&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;(held this year from 12 to 14 July), the town revels in a “wild west” atmosphere, with local merchants selling leather saddles, handcrafted bush hats and the oversized belt buckle of your bronco-bustin’ dreams. Mareeba’s main street is even wide enough for a high-noon showdown. Once the heart of Australia’s largest tobacco growing region, Mareeba now turns its soil to more wholesome produce, with organic coffee plantations, distilleries, a mango winery and abundant fruit and nut crops. For a sample, visit one of the many farms that offer tasting menus, or try&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.foodtrailtours.com.au/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;Food Trail Tours&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;for guided gourmandising.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; color: #505050; font-family: arial, helvetica, sans-serif; font-size: 14px; line-height: 1.286em; padding: 0px 0px 10px;&quot;&gt;
Heading north towards Queensland’s rugged Cape York Peninsula, twitchers should stop off at the&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.mareebawetlands.org/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;Mareeba Wetlands&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;just out of town, a 2,000 hectare sanctuary that harbours more than 200 bird species, as well as the upmarket&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.jabirusafarilodge.com.au/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;Jabiru Safari Lodge&lt;/a&gt;, a collection of lagoon-side African-style safari cabins ideally placed for wildlife watching and unwinding.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; color: #505050; font-family: arial, helvetica, sans-serif; font-size: 14px; line-height: 1.286em; padding: 0px 0px 10px;&quot;&gt;
Named after the man – 19th-century pastoralist John Atherton – who gave the region its name, Atherton, located 30km south of Mareeba, is a bustling, central country town that makes an ideal base for exploring the delights of the southern Tablelands. Old-school accommodation at any of Atherton’s&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.gdaypubs.com.au/QLD/atherton.html&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;four traditional pubs&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;ensures an authentic stay, while the lure of&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.crystalcaves.com.au/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;Crystal Caves&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;– a gaudily fabulous mineralogical museum that houses the world’s biggest amethyst geode (more than 3m high and weighing 2.5 tonnes) – and the fastidiously restored late 19th-century&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.houwang.org.au/&quot; style=&quot;color: black; outline-style: none; text-decoration: none;&quot;&gt;Hou Wang Temple&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;– one of the oldest original Chinese temples in Australia – tempt day tippers to linger longer.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; color: #505050; font-family: arial, helvetica, sans-serif; font-size: 14px; line-height: 1.286em; padding: 0px 0px 10px;&quot;&gt;
It was John Atherton who also, accidentally, named one of the Tablelands’ most beloved outdoor playgrounds, the nearby Lake Tinaroo. Locals swear that in 1875 Atherton stumbled across a deposit of alluvial tin and, in a fit of excitement, shouted “Tin! Hurroo!” The excitement has not died down since, with Tinaroo becoming a favourite for Tablelanders as well as Cairnsites fleeing seasonal jellyfish, the threat of giant crocs and the swelter of the lowlands. People flock to its cool, clean waters for boating, water skiing and lazy shoreline lolling. It is also renowned as one of the best barramundi fishing spots in Australia. The sprawling lake, estimated at being two thirds the area of Sydney Harbour, is framed by the Danbulla Forest, a green blanket of rainforest, pine and scrub that offers refuge to kangaroos, bird colonies and platypus.&lt;/div&gt;

An own-label supermarket gin costing less than £10 has won a top award and seen off competition from well-known brands and niche rivals costing more than five times its price.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at; border-collapse: collapse; margin-bottom: 13px; padding: 0px;&quot;&gt;
&lt;span style=&quot;color: #005689;&quot;&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at;&quot;&gt;Aldi&#39;s Oliver Cromwell London Dry Gin&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;, which costs £9.65 for a 70cl bottle, impressed judges in blind taste tests at the prestigious International&amp;nbsp;&lt;span style=&quot;color: #005689;&quot;&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at;&quot;&gt;Spirits&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&amp;nbsp;Challenge 2013. It picked up a silver medal alongside more expensive rivals including The London No 1 Gin, which sells for £35 at Harrods, and the Worship Street Whistling Shop Cream Gin, which costs £55.95.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at; border-collapse: collapse; margin-bottom: 13px; padding: 0px;&quot;&gt;
The so-called&amp;nbsp;&lt;span style=&quot;color: #005689;&quot;&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at;&quot;&gt;Bathtub Gin&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&amp;nbsp;from the Professor Cornelius Ampleforth range of spirits and liqueurs was awarded a gold medal in the premium and super premium categories. Costing £32.95 for a 70cl bottle, it is made in Tunbridge Wells, Kent.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at; border-collapse: collapse; margin-bottom: 13px; padding: 0px;&quot;&gt;
Famous mainstream brands such as Bombay Sapphire (£21.70) and artisan favourite Hendricks (£26.39) fell short in the eyes of the experts. Both were awarded bronze medals despite being more than twice as expensive as their value&amp;nbsp;&lt;span style=&quot;color: #005689;&quot;&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at;&quot;&gt;Aldi&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&amp;nbsp;rival.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at; border-collapse: collapse; margin-bottom: 13px; padding: 0px;&quot;&gt;
Described as having a &quot;ripe, citrus aroma with rounded spice and a touch of juniper&quot;, Aldi&#39;s Oliver Cromwell London Dry Gin is distilled &quot;for a clear, crisp, complex flavour&quot;.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at; border-collapse: collapse; margin-bottom: 13px; padding: 0px;&quot;&gt;
Several other products in Aldi&#39;s spirits range were also highly decorated, with two of its vodkas picking up silver awards and its amaretto, white rum and peach schnapps taking bronze awards in the liqueurs category.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at; border-collapse: collapse; margin-bottom: 13px; padding: 0px;&quot;&gt;
Tony Baines, managing director of buying at Aldi, said: &quot;Our expert buyer works closely with some of the world&#39;s leading distilleries to enable us to deliver high-quality own-label spirits to our customers, so it is fantastic that our commitment to quality has been recognised by as prestigious a group as the ISC tasting panel.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at; border-collapse: collapse; margin-bottom: 13px; padding: 0px;&quot;&gt;
&quot;It&#39;s safe to say we&#39;re all in high spirits today – and we hope our customers will enjoy raising a glass of gin and tonic to our success.&quot;&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at; border-collapse: collapse; margin-bottom: 13px; padding: 0px;&quot;&gt;
&lt;span style=&quot;color: #005689;&quot;&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at;&quot;&gt;Supermarkets&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&amp;nbsp;have reported a steady rise in gin sales amid new interest from consumers in mixing their own cocktails after a flurry of new product launches. Waitrose&#39;s Heston from Waitrose gin – made with British potatoes and infused with the chef&#39;s signature Earl Grey tea and lemon – hit the shelves last autumn and retails at £22 for a 70cl bottle.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-repeat: no-repeat no-repeat; border-collapse: collapse; margin-bottom: 13px; padding: 0px;&quot;&gt;
The Waitrose spirits buyer Hercehelle Perez Terrado said: &quot;Gin is the trendiest tipple around, with sales up 13% year on year at Waitrose. Underground gin bars are popping up all over London and pubs are starting to sell lesser known craft brands. The scope for creativity in the blend of botanicals is what makes gin so special.&quot;&lt;/div&gt;

New measurements suggest the Earth&#39;s inner core is far hotter than prior experiments suggested, putting it at 6,000C - as hot as the Sun&#39;s surface.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
The solid iron core is actually crystalline, surrounded by liquid.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
But the temperature at which that crystal can form had been a subject of long-running debate.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
Experiments&amp;nbsp;outlined in Science&amp;nbsp;used X-rays to probe tiny samples of iron at extraordinary pressures to examine how the iron crystals form and melt.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
Seismic waves captured after earthquakes around the globe can give a great deal of information as to the thickness and density of layers in the Earth, but they give no indication of temperature.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
That has to be worked out either in computer models that simulate the Earth&#39;s insides, or in the laboratory.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;span class=&quot;cross-head&quot; style=&quot;background-color: white; color: #505050; display: block;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.231em; font-weight: bold; line-height: 16px; margin: 0px 0px 16px; text-rendering: optimizelegibility;&quot;&gt;X-ray vision&lt;/span&gt;&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
Measurements in the early 1990s of iron&#39;s &quot;melting curves&quot; - from which the core&#39;s temperature can be deduced - suggested a core temperature of about 5,000C.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
&quot;It was just the beginning of these kinds of measurements so they made a first estimate... to constrain the temperature inside the Earth,&quot; said Agnes Dewaele of the French research agency CEA and a co-author of the new research.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div class=&quot;caption body-narrow-width&quot; style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: both; color: #505050; display: inline; float: right;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 13px; line-height: 16px; margin: 0px -160px 16px 16px; position: relative;&quot;&gt;
&lt;img alt=&quot;X-ray diffraction setup at ESRF&quot; height=&quot;250&quot; src=&quot;http://news.bbcimg.co.uk/media/images/67259000/jpg/_67259064_image4.jpg&quot; style=&quot;-webkit-user-select: none; border: 0px; font-style: italic; letter-spacing: 0px; position: relative;&quot; width=&quot;304&quot; /&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;display: block; width: 304px;&quot;&gt;Iron samples were subjected to enormous pressures before being probed with a spray of intense X-rays&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
&quot;Other people made other measurements and calculations with computers and nothing was in agreement. It was not good for our field that we didn&#39;t agree with each other,&quot; she told BBC News.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
The core temperature is crucial to a number of disciplines that study regions of our planet&#39;s interior that will never be accessed directly - guiding our understanding of everything from earthquakes to the Earth&#39;s magnetic field.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
&quot;We have to give answers to geophysicists, seismologists, geodynamicists - they need some data to feed their computer models,&quot; Dr Dewaele said.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
The team has now revisited those 20-year-old measurements, making use of the European Synchrotron Radiation Facility - one of the world&#39;s most intense sources of X-rays.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
To replicate the enormous pressures at the core boundary - more than a million times the pressure at sea level - they used a device called a diamond anvil cell - essentially a tiny sample held between the points of two precision-machined synthetic diamonds.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
Once the team&#39;s iron samples were subjected to the high pressures and high temperatures using a laser, the scientists used X-ray beams to carry out &quot;diffraction&quot; - bouncing X-rays off the nuclei of the iron atoms and watching how the pattern changed as the iron changed from solid to liquid.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
Those diffraction patterns give more insight into partially molten states of iron, which the team believes were what the researchers were measuring in the first experiments.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
They suggest a core temperature of about 6,000C, give or take 500C - roughly that of the Sun&#39;s surface.&lt;/div&gt;
&lt;div style=&quot;background-color: white; clear: left; color: #333333; font-family: Arial, Helmet, Freesans, sans-serif; font-size: 1.077em; line-height: 18px; margin-bottom: 18px; padding: 0px; text-rendering: auto;&quot;&gt;
But importantly, Dr Dewaele said, &quot;now everything agrees&quot;.&lt;/div&gt;

&lt;b&gt;LONDON: Three British Muslims were jailed on Friday for planning what a court heard was an Al-Qaeda-backed plot to carry out a string of bombings that they hoped would rival 9/11 and the 2005 London attacks.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Ringleader Irfan Naseer received a life sentence, his right-hand man Irfan Khalid was jailed for 18 years and co-conspirator Ashik Ali was jailed for 15 years by a judge at Woolwich Crown Court in southeast London.&lt;br /&gt;
Naseer, 31, and Khalid and Ali, both 28, were convicted in February of engaging in conduct in preparation of terrorist acts, through an extremist plot to set off eight rucksack bombs in crowded areas and possibly other timed devices.&lt;br /&gt;
&quot;Your plot had the blessing of Al-Qaeda and you intended to further the aims of Al-Qaeda,&quot; Judge Richard Henriques said as he sentenced the three men.&lt;br /&gt;
The group, all from Birmingham in central England, were heavily influenced by the teachings of American-born Al-Qaeda preacher Anwar al-Awlaki, who was killed by a drone strike in Yemen in September 2011, police said. (AFP)&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;b&gt;SYDNEY: Pakistani asylum-seeker Fawad Ahmed has signed to play with Australian state side Victoria for the next three seasons, Cricket Victoria said on Friday.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Leg-spinner Ahmed, who could be in contention to play for Australia in the Ashes series in England in July if he is granted citizenship on time, was named in Victoria&#39;s squad for the next Australian season. &quot;Fawad Ahmed was the success story from last year and we&#39;re extremely happy to have signed him for the next three seasons,&quot; Victoria coach Greg Shipperd said in a statement.&lt;br /&gt;
The 31-year-old leg-spinner was handed a permanent visa to remain in Australia in November after leaving his home in the border region near Afghanistan, where he said he was targeted by Muslim extremists.&lt;br /&gt;
But to play for Australia in the Ashes from July he needs fast-tracked citizenship and an Australian passport.&lt;br /&gt;
Otherwise, under International Cricket Council rules, he will not become available until August 18, before the fifth Test at the Oval.&lt;br /&gt;
Ahmed played three Sheffield Shield games for Victoria late last season and took 16 wickets at 28.37, bringing him to the notice of Australian selectors given a dearth of spin bowlers of Test quality. &quot;Fawad Ahmed is a mature and very good leg-spinner,&quot; chairman of selectors John Inverarity said last month. &quot;I&#39;ve seen quite a bit of him and all those who have played against him, and the coaching staff, rate him as a good bowler. &quot;He would certainly come under consideration. It will all be considered on merit. He will be treated no differently from anybody else.&quot;&lt;br /&gt;
Of his chances of playing for Australia, Ahmed told reporters last month &quot;Playing Test cricket is the dream for any single cricketer, very, very exciting. &quot;Like a dream, especially playing for Australia in an Ashes against England. That would be a dream for me and would be amazing. I just only can imagine.&quot;&lt;br /&gt;
Cricket Victoria also announced Friday that former Australian all-rounder Dan Christian would be playing for Victoria from next season. (AFP)&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;b&gt;RAWALPINDI: The Anti-Terrorism Court on Friday gave the FIA physical remand of former president General (retd) Pervez Musharraf in the Benazir Bhutto murder case. Geo News reported.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
The retired General who is already serving a two-week house arrest, set to expire on May 4 for sacking judges when he imposed emergency rule in November 2007, was presented before the ATC on Friday morning where he was served the fresh remand order which he will serve concurrently.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;b&gt;Joint Investigation team to Interrogate&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
The Federal Investigation Agency (FIA) says a joint investigation team will interrogate General (retired) Pervez Musharraf regarding why Benazir Bhutto’s post mortem was stopped, whether the retired General threatened Bhutto in 2008 over the phone, and on whose authorization did the Interior Ministry conducted the press conference after Bhutto’s death.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;b&gt;Mark Siegel agrees to testify&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
The FIA has also contacted American journalist Mark Siegel, an important witness whom the FIA has requested to appear before a trial court to record his testimony. Sources add, that Siegel has agreed to the FIA’s request.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;b&gt;In Court today&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Pervez Musharraf appeared before the ATC in Rawalpindi for his remand hearing under tight security. He is accused of conspiracy to murder former prime minister Benazir Bhutto, who died in December 2007.&lt;br /&gt;
&quot;We requested a three-day remand of retired general Pervez Musharraf and&lt;br /&gt;
judge Chaudhry Habib-ur Rehman gave a three-day remand and adjourned the case until Monday,&quot; prosecutor Chaudhry Azhar told.&lt;br /&gt;
The formal application seeking physical remand of Musharraf had been submitted before the ATC on Thursday.&lt;br /&gt;
The ATC had also allowed the FIA to include Pervez Musharraf in the investigation of Benazir Bhutto murder case. Prosecutor Chaudhry Zulfiqar represented FIA and presented his arguments while Afshan Adil Advocate represented Pervez Musharraf.&lt;br /&gt;
After listening to the arguments, the court had allowed FIA to formally arrest Musharraf and include him in the investigation.&lt;br /&gt;
Musharraf is accused of involvement in a conspiracy to murder Benazir Bhutto, who died in a gun and suicide attack in December 2007. It is one of the three cases he is fighting in the courts since returning home last month after four years in self-imposed exile.&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;b&gt;PARIS: Enigmatic traces of water in the upper atmosphere of Jupiter came from a comet that crashed into the giant planet in 1994, the European Space Agency (ESA) said on Tuesday.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Astronomers have been debating the water for 15 years after telltale molecules were spotted by an infrared telescope.&lt;br /&gt;
Some argued the water brewed up from lower levels of the gassy planet, but others said it could not have crossed a &quot;cold barrier&quot; separating the stratosphere from the cloud level below.&lt;br /&gt;
ESA&#39;s deep-space Herschel telescope has now found that most of the water is concentrated in Jupiter&#39;s southern hemisphere.&lt;br /&gt;
The molecules are clustered at high altitude around the sites where 21 fragments from Comet Shoemaker-Levy 9 whacked into Jupiter in July 1994 in one of the most spectacular recorded events in astronomy.&lt;br /&gt;
The collisions left dark scars in Jupiter&#39;s roiling atmosphere that persisted for weeks.&lt;br /&gt;
&quot;According to our models, as much as 95 percent of the water in the stratosphere is due to the comet impact,&quot; said Thibault Cavalie of the Bordeaux Astrophysics Laboratory in southwestern France.&lt;br /&gt;
Other potential sources, including water vapour disgorged by one of Jupiter&#39;s icy moons or interplanetary particles of icy dust, can be ruled out, he said in a press release issued by ESA.&lt;br /&gt;
The study appears in the European journal Astronomy and Astrophysics.&lt;br /&gt;
Comets are believed to be primeval balls of ice and dust left over from the building of the Solar System.&lt;br /&gt;
Cometary bombardment is believed by some experts to have provided the infant Earth with its abundance of water, the stuff of life. (AFP)&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;b&gt;LONDON: Nearly a century after they were killed in action, four British First World War soldiers will Tuesday finally be laid to rest with full military honours.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
The soldiers, two of whom have been identified, are to be re-interred in the Honourable Artillery Company (HAC) Cemetery at Ecoust-Saint-Mein near the northern town of Arras in a ceremony attended by relatives and Prince Michael of Kent.&lt;br /&gt;
Lieutenant John Harold Pritchard and Private Christopher Douglas Elphick were both killed during an attack by German forces near Bullecourt on the Hindenburg Line on the morning of May 15, 1917.&lt;br /&gt;
Their bodies were discovered with two other sets of remains in 2009 when a local farmer was clearing a field.&lt;br /&gt;
Pritchard, 31 at the time of his death, was identified by a silver identity bracelet, and Elphick, 28, by a signet ring bearing his initials.&lt;br /&gt;
A former chorister and head boy at St Paul&#39;s cathedral school, Pritchard had joined the HAC as a reservist in 1909 and was part of the first wave of British soldiers to be sent into action when war broke out in 1914.&lt;br /&gt;
Injured in 1915, he could have opted for a desk job in London but chose to return to France, surviving the horrors of the Somme in 1916 before being slain as he led his men into a battle in which they were almost all killed.&lt;br /&gt;
Elphick, an insurance clerk, had joined up in 1915 and arrived in France in November 1916, three months after the birth of his son, Ronald Douglas, who was to serve in the HAC during World War II.&lt;br /&gt;
Ronald Douglas&#39;s sons, Chris and Martin Elphick, are due to attend Tuesday&#39;s ceremony while the Pritchard family are to be represented by his nephew Harold Shell and great nieces Janet Shell and Jennifer Sutton.&lt;br /&gt;
Prince Michael, a cousin of Queen Elizabeth II, will be present in his role as HAC Royal Honorary Colonel.&lt;br /&gt;
The two sets of unidentified remains will be interred as &quot;HAC soldiers known unto God.&quot;&lt;br /&gt;
It is understood DNA samples have been taken to enable positive identification of the unknown soldiers should any relatives come forward in the future. (AFP)&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;b&gt;SAN FRANCISCO: Microsoft is expected to unveil in May a successor to Xbox 360 videogame consoles that have been evolving into hubs for home entertainment in the digital age.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Microsoft sent out invitations Wednesday to a May 21 event at its main campus in Redmond, Washington at which Xbox team will reveal a &quot;new generation.&quot;&lt;br /&gt;
Industry tracker NPD Group reported last week that as of the end of March, the Xbox 360 had been the top-selling console in the United States for 20 consecutive months.&lt;br /&gt;
More than 70 million Xbox 360 consoles have been sold worldwide since they were introduced in November 2005.&lt;br /&gt;
A new-generation Xbox would take the field against the latest offerings from Sony and Nintendo.&lt;br /&gt;
Sony announced a new generation PlayStation 4 system in February and laid out its vision for the &quot;future of gaming&quot; in a world rich with mobile gadgets and play streamed from the Internet cloud.&lt;br /&gt;
Sony spoke ambiguously about the device, leaving much to the imagination during a two-hour presentation in New York City.&lt;br /&gt;
Industry insiders anticipate learning more from Sony and Microsoft, and perhaps even getting their hands on new consoles, at a premier E3 videogame conference that will take place in Los Angeles in June.&lt;br /&gt;
Low-cost or free games on smartphones or tablet computers are increasing the pressure on videogame companies to deliver experiences worth players&#39; time and money.&lt;br /&gt;
Features being incorporated into new consoles include games relying on connections to servers in the Internet &quot;cloud&quot; and synching play, movie viewing and social networking with tablets, smartphones and other devices.&lt;br /&gt;
A PlaySation App will let iPhones, iPads or Android-powered smartphones or tablets be used as &quot;second screens&quot; augmenting play taking place on televisions connected to PS4 consoles, according to Sony.&lt;br /&gt;
Sony said the PS4 would hit the market in time for the year-end holiday season but did not provide details.&lt;br /&gt;
The PS4 will succeed PlayStation 3 consoles that began their lifespan in late 2006.&lt;br /&gt;
Nintendo released a new-generation Wii U console late last year but said on Wednesday that the Japanese firm &quot;was not able to maintain the initial sales momentum after the beginning of 2013 due to a delay in the development of subsequent software titles.&quot;&lt;br /&gt;
Nintendo has been banking on the Wii U to boost its fading fortunes after the original Wii, launched in 2006, proved a huge success as it lured legions of casual gamers with motion-sensing controls.&lt;br /&gt;
With the Wii U, Nintendo vowed to start a trend in &quot;asymmetrical play&quot; that gives players using GamePad tablets different in-game perspectives and roles than those using traditional wand controllers.&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;b&gt;MADRID: A 16th century religious tapestry which police suspect was stolen by one of Europe&#39;s most prolific art thieves from a cathedral in Spain in 1979 has returned to the country after an odyssey that took it to five countries.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Culture Minister Jose Ignacio Wert and Interior Minister Jorge Fernandez Diaz presented the wool and silk tapestry, depicting the Virgin Mary and baby Jesus, Thursday at a Madrid news conference a day after it was handed over to Spanish officials from the US customs service.&lt;br /&gt;
The US Homeland Security Investigations unit seized the artefact last November from the unidentified Texas business that had bought it at auction three years ago for $369,000.&lt;br /&gt;
The tapestry had been stolen in December 1979 from the Cathedral of Saint Vincent in Roda de Isabena in the Aragon region of northeastern Spain &quot;apparently&quot; by Rene Alphonse Van Den Berghe, also known as Erik the Belgian, a police spokesman said.&lt;br /&gt;
Van Den Berghen is suspected of carrying out several heist of artworks from churches across Europe.&lt;br /&gt;
The tapestry was one several works of art that were taken during the break-in at the cathedral in Roda de Isabena, a fortified town in the Spanish Pyrenees, the Spanish culture and interior ministries said in a joint statement.&lt;br /&gt;
&quot;Since its theft in 1979 the tapestry has made many trips as it was successively bought and sold in the art market and it passed through five countries: Belgium, Germany, Italy, France and finally the United States,&quot; it said.&lt;br /&gt;
The tapestry was identified in 2010 by a researcher from the Museum of Lleida, Carmen Berlabe, who spotted it on sale in an online catalogue of a gallery that specialises in the sale of old tapestries in the Belgian city of Mechelen, the police spokesman said.&lt;br /&gt;
Police then launched their investigation which led to its discovery in Houston.&lt;br /&gt;
The tapestry will now undergo a restoration by the Spanish Cultural Heritage Institute, a unit of the culture ministry.&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;b&gt;LAHORE: As election campaign continues in Punjab with full swing, back-to-back bombings in three other provinces of the country have overshadowed the campaign.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
The purpose of enemies of Pakistani society and its system had become clear over the past 24 hours as eleven explosions occurred in Sindh, Balochistan and Khyber Pakhtunkhwa provinces, killing at least eleven people and injuring more than 60.&lt;br /&gt;
During the last 24 hours, seven bombs exploded in the capital of Balochistan. On Tuesday, String of blasts in Quetta challenged the writ of the government in which four people were killed.&lt;br /&gt;
In Khyber Pakhtunkhwa, a bomb went off at Sarki Gate in the provincial capital, Peshawar, leaving two people injured.&lt;br /&gt;
In Sindh, the death toll have reached to five while 15 were reportedly injured as a result of blast that took place on Tuesday near the election office of Muttahida Qaumi Movement in Karachi.&lt;br /&gt;
Prior to the aforesaid attacks, the election office and the electoral candidates of Awami National Party (ANP) were also targeted.&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;b&gt;KARACHI: Unidentified assailants hurled a hand grenade at a house located in Gulshan e Iqbal area of the metropolis and fled away; however, no casualty was reported.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
According to the police, the unidentified assailants riding motorbike attacked a house near Bait ul Mukarram mosque with the hand grenade.&lt;br /&gt;
The police said that the attack was carried out at the house of a carpet shop owner. It further said that his shop was also assaulted with the grenade two weeks ago.&lt;br /&gt;
The sources said that the shop owner was demanded to pay extortion money, and over non-payment his shop and house were targeted.&lt;br /&gt;
